In 2015, the company Designers revolt was prosecuted for selling copies of design furniture and lamps for several years, mainly to Swedish customers.

Three people behind the company were sentenced to prison for between 1.5-2 years and a fourth person was sentenced to a suspended sentence and a daily fine.

The prince was accused

As a designer, Prince Carl Philip has made design collaborations with several Swedish companies.

In 2013, the prince together with Rörstrand released a porcelain collection.

He was later accused of stealing the idea because the series was considered too reminiscent of a porcelain series that designer Paul Hoff had previously executed for Gustafsberg.

- We have received confirmation from the Court that he has not seen this series.

But it is a very natural concept because Prince Carl Philip has such a great interest in nature and animals.

And nature in interior design is a hot trend that we have built on, said Martina Hansson at Rörstrand at the time.
